MySQL fout - bij database overzetten

Pagina: 1
Acties:
  • 661 views

Onderwerpen


Acties:
  • 0 Henk 'm!

  • londemanmp
  • Registratie: Februari 2009
  • Nu online
Beste tweakers

ik probeer een database over te zetten van phpmyadmin 3.4.10 ( op localhost ) naar phpmyadmin 3.4.5 ( op webserver )

maar krijg een fout :

code:
1
2
3
4
MySQL retourneerde: 

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'USING BTREE
) ENGINE=InnoDB  DEFAULT CHARSET=utf8 AUTO_INCREMENT=10' at line 11


Komt deze fout door de versie van Phpmyadmin ?

heb DROP TABLE al een keer aan en uit gezet maar mocht niet baten, structuur etc. is gewoon UTF8

Enig idee wat dit kan zijn ?

Acties:
  • 0 Henk 'm!

  • TheRookie
  • Registratie: December 2001
  • Niet online

TheRookie

Nu met R1200RT

Welke versie van MySQL heb je lokaal staan, en welke versie op de webserver ?
Gebruik je wellicht lokaal functionaliteit die op de webserver versie niet beschikbaar is ?

Als ik google op 'mysql error using btree' krijg ik flink wat hits :)

Acties:
  • 0 Henk 'm!

Verwijderd

Welke mysql versie maak je gebruik van?
Probeer anders eens zonder de USING BTREE.

[ Voor 143% gewijzigd door Verwijderd op 10-06-2013 10:05 ]


Acties:
  • 0 Henk 'm!

  • PatrickH89
  • Registratie: November 2009
  • Laatst online: 16-09 21:41
Is MySQL < 5.0 niet inmiddels ook flink aan de leeftijd?

Acties:
  • 0 Henk 'm!

  • P.O. Box
  • Registratie: Augustus 2005
  • Niet online
PatrickH89 schreef op maandag 10 juni 2013 @ 10:01:
Is MySQL < 5.0 niet inmiddels ook flink aan de leeftijd?
de versies die genoemd worden zijn phpMyAdmin versies... geen mySQL versies....

TS: wat geeft
SQL:
1
select version();

voor resultaat op je localhost en op je webserver?

Acties:
  • 0 Henk 'm!

  • Oid
  • Registratie: November 2002
  • Niet online

Oid

gebruik echte tools?

mysqldump

Acties:
  • 0 Henk 'm!

  • Onoffon
  • Registratie: April 2006
  • Laatst online: 21-09 14:57
Wellicht kun je proberen via een .csv. bestand via de import / export functie van phpmyadmin de DB over te zetten? even vogelen, maar aangezien het toch maar een eenmalige actie is neem ik aan?

[ Voor 43% gewijzigd door Onoffon op 10-06-2013 13:29 ]

Just a simple thought....


Acties:
  • 0 Henk 'm!

  • londemanmp
  • Registratie: Februari 2009
  • Nu online
Onoffon schreef op maandag 10 juni 2013 @ 13:28:
Wellicht kun je proberen via een .csv. bestand via de import / export functie van phpmyadmin de DB over te zetten? even vogelen, maar aangezien het toch maar een eenmalige actie is neem ik aan?
Via een .csv file is het inderdaad handig MAAR hij zet hem op de Phpmyadmin als Table in de database naam.

Hoe is dit te veranderen ?

Acties:
  • 0 Henk 'm!

  • P.O. Box
  • Registratie: Augustus 2005
  • Niet online
euh? zoek eens op het renamen van een table? die optie zit vast (ik weet het wel zeker) ergens in phpMyAdmin...

Acties:
  • 0 Henk 'm!

  • Creepy
  • Registratie: Juni 2001
  • Laatst online: 21-09 21:47

Creepy

Tactical Espionage Splatterer

Aangezien je het andere advies lijkt te negeren, je geen antwoord geeft op vragen zoals welke MySQL versie je nu lokaal en op je server draait en je ook nog maar vragen blijft stellen zonder zelf aan te geven wat je nu zelf al hebt geprobreerd en wat daar niet mee lukt, sluit ik je topic.

Een tabelnaam aanpassen kan prima in PHPMyAdmin. Dat kan je erg eenvoudig zelf even uitproberen of opzoeken hoe dat werkt. PRG is een forum waar het om zelf programmeren draait maar voorlopig lijk je echter zelf nog geen code te schrijven.

"I had a problem, I solved it with regular expressions. Now I have two problems". That's shows a lack of appreciation for regular expressions: "I know have _star_ problems" --Kevlin Henney

Pagina: 1

Dit topic is gesloten.